> Ok now we know the cause. The cure needs to be a bit different I think
> since this is performance critical code and the interrupt operations are
> high latency.
>
> Subject: slub: disable interrupts in cmpxchg_double_slab when falling back to pagelock (V2)
>
> Split cmpxchg_double_slab into two functions. One for the case where we know that
> interrupts are disabled (and therefore the fallback does not need to disable
> interrupts) and one for the other cases where fallback will also disable interrupts.
>
> This fixes the issue that __slab_free called cmpxchg_double_slab in some scenarios
> without disabling interrupts.
>
> Signed-off-by: Christoph Lameter <cl@linux.com>

As you'd expect, this patch worked too.
